Akash Deep ruled out of Sydney Test

Thursday, 02-Jan-2025
News

Indian pacer Akash Deep has been ruled out of the fifth and final Test of the ongoing Border-Gavaskar Trophy against Australia due to a back issue. Akash Deep's absence was confirmed by Indian head coach Gautam Gambhir during the pre-match press conference. 

Akash secured five wickets in the Brisbane and Melbourne Test. He returned with the figures of 1/95 and 2/28 in the third Test, which was held in Gabba, of the series. In the Melbourne Test, he took two wickets in the first innings but failed to claim any wickets in the second innings despite showing significant consistency.

"Akash Deep is out because he has got a back issue," Gambhir said in the press conference. 

His exclusion comes at a critical time, with the series poised on a knife-edge. The final Test will be instrumental in determining the fate of team India for the World Test Championshp final. Moreover, it remains a must-win battle for India in order to level the series. 

Currently, Australia are leading the series 2-1. With Akash Deep out of the equation, India are expected to turn to one of the other pace bowlers in the squad to fill the gap.
